Output ecda760b6f55a891d6ee7da857dd39a7835d5d96dde75d512bf3ecec4e446d37:0

value
666369
script pubkey
OP_0 OP_PUSHBYTES_20 c67da47e5df051440713441d586fe7198f03f3be
address
bc1qce76glja7pg5gpcngsw4sml8rx8s8ua7kwg5gm
transaction
ecda760b6f55a891d6ee7da857dd39a7835d5d96dde75d512bf3ecec4e446d37
confirmations
25060
spent
true